Disregard my initial explanation, there is no inconsistency!

In the Potters' case, they (the people, not their residence at Godric's Hollow) were the subjects of the charm. That means, no one in the world except for Pettigrew (and then Voldemort) could physically see them.

That is not true at all.

Firstly, look at what Flitwick says. Voldy could search their village all he wants, but he wouldn't find them. It the charm only concealed the two of them, then their house would be easily visible to him. How easy for the Death Eaters to simply blow it up when they were inside. The Fidelius Charm would then only be like a permanent invisibility cloak.

Second, look at Lily's letter to Sirius (which is found in DH). She says James was getting pissed off cooped in the house, and without the invisibility cloak, couldn't go out on excursions. If James himself was the secret, he could have gone and stood in front of Voldy, and no one would know! Plus, they have Bathilda Bagshot visiting them, Sirius and Petunia sending them gifts, etc. If they were now secrets, people would not be able to locate them at all!


All that holds for them being Secret as well. Bathilda Baghot could not visit them if their house was Secret, even if they were not. And Nobody could send them gifts if their house was Secret, as owls (or Postmen, for that matter) would not find it. I don't have the book handy. Are you sure all this happens after they have been subjected to the Secrecy Charm, rather than them merely being in (normal) hiding at this point?

Lastly, there's this from DH:

And along a new and darker street he moved, and now his destination was in sight at last, the Fidelius Charm broken, though they did not know it yet. . . .


That is fine either way.

This is Voldemort about to kill the Potters. Clearly, the Breaking of the Charm makes their house visible, not just them.


That is not a given from your quote.

In the case of Shell Cottage, and 12 Grimmauld Place, it was the location of the building that was the secret, not the inhabitants.

As I said, that's not true at all.


Fair enough and I see what you're getting at, but how would they survive? Stay cooped up in their house all the time? Sure, if DD was in on the secret, he could do groceries for them, but what if Voldemort captured and distilled the secret of the Potters' whereabouts from him?

You can't do that. Only the Secret Keeper can reveal the secret. Any others in on it can be tortured all they want, but it wouldn't help.


This is correct.

Plus, they were copped up anyway, as Lily's letter reveals.


Yes. But when was the letter written?
And either way, they would not be able to interact with the world.

And before you quote Gamp's Law, remember: the Death Eaters knew the general location of #12 Grimmauld Place but they couldn't simply fire curses at it and get it demolished!


Because the location was the secret. To fire at something, it has to be there in your awareness.

If it was the Potter's that were hidden and not their house, the Death Eaters could indeed have blasted it.


But would they have known what to blast?
